    Hawks Go Down Quietly In 97-66 Loss To Timberwolves

    Recap | Box Score | Highlights

    MVP: Anthony Bennett. Bennet had a bounce back game after a terrible outing against the Memphis Grizzlies on Friday night. Bennett scored a game high 26 points and grabbed a game high 14 rebounds in the dominating win over the Atlanta Hawks.

    LVP: Paul Millsap and Jeff Teague. Millsap and Teague are co-LVP's because both players failed to show up in a game they needed to win to keep pace in the eastern conference playoff race. Millsap finished with just 7 points while Teague scored 10 while shooting 4-of-10 from the field.

    X-Factor: Anderson Varejao. Andy V had his best game of the year coming off the bench to score 13 points on 6-of-7 shooting and pulling down 9 rebounds in 19 minutes of action. A contender could definitely use his services later in the season.

    Rookie Watch: Dennis Schroder. The rookie point guard only saw 12 minutes of action and finished with 6 points and 2 assist on 3-of-8 shooting.

            Minnesota Acquire Trio From Chicago


            Minnesota -- General Manager Tennell Williams announced that the team has acquired a trio of players from the Chicago Bulls in a 4 player deal today. Forwards Erik Murphy and Shengelia and point guard Jimmer Fredette will be coming to Minnesota. The T-Wolves will send guard J.J. Barea and a 2014 2nd round pick to Chicago.

            "These are three young players who could continue to help our rebuild process, said Williams. They didn't get much playing team in Chicago because of all the talent that was ahead of them. But they will get the chance to show us what they got."

            The Bulls will also send the Wolves a conditional 2nd round pick.

                Waiter's 30 Help Timberwolves Hold Off Rockets

                Recap | Box Score | Highlights

                MVP: Dion Waiters. Waiters finished with a game high 30 points to go along with 4 rebounds, 3 assist, and 2 steals. Even though he didn't shoot well (9-of-21) he made them when he needed to ending a few Rocket comeback attempts in the 4th quarter.

                LVP: Patrick Beverly. Not really known for his offense, Beverly was trigger happy against the T-Wolves taking a team high 23 shots to score 11 points in the loss. You know this has to tick Howard off getting just 9 shot attempts while Beverly was just chucking away all game long.

                X-Factor: Jimmer Fredette. The newly acquired guard was a big time spark plug off the bench for the Wolves. Fredette came in early in the 2nd quarter and proceded to knock down three straight treys on his way to scoring 15 points in his debut for the T-Wolves.

                Rookie Watch: Anthony Bennett. The number one pick had a 0 point first half but turned things around in the 2nd half finishing with 24 points and 8 rebounds.

                                Clippers, Timberwolves, Jazz Complete 3 Team Deal


                                With just 24 hours before the trade deadline, the Los Angeles Clippers, the Minnesota Timberwolves, and the Utah Jazz have completed a 3 team 5 player deal.

                                The Clippers will receive SF Corey Brewer PG Ramon Sessions, and SG Alexey Shved from the Timberwolves. The T-Wolves will be getting SG Reggie Bullock, SF Richard Jefferson, Utah's 2014 2nd rounder, and the Clippers 2014 2nd rounder. The Utah Jazz will receive SF Danny Granger and cash in the deal.

                                Why the Clippers did the deal:

                                The Clippers get rid of an unhappy Granger who complained behind closed doors about wanting to be a starter on the team. The 8 year pro out of New Mexico was getting a career low 11.5 mpg coming of the Clippers bench. Brewer and Sessions will be an excellent fit to the bench unit. Bullock was also causing problems in the locker room with his complaints about not seeing the court. The rookie out of North Carolina has only appeared in 5 games this season.

                                Why the Timberwolves did the deal:

                                One reason. More assets. Since trading Kevin Love, the Wolves have been wheeling and dealing all season long moving talented players like Nikola Pekovic and J.J. Barea for cap relief and draft picks, building up their trade assets in the process. In this deal they get a talented young prospect in Bullock and two 2nd round picks in a deep draft this summer. Their also off the hook for the remaining 2 years of Brewer's deal.

                                Why the Jazz did the deal:

                                The Jazz, who are 1/2 back of the 8th spot, wants to make a run at the playoffs and Granger is an instant upgrade at the three spot over Richard Jefferson.
